Nottingham Forest Owner Admits Defeat in Race for Midfielder - "What More Can Be Done?"

Summary by Sport Witness
Nottingham Forest owner Evangelos Marinakis has admitted defeat in an attempt to sign Gustavo Puerta, with the midfielder choosing Benfica instead. The Premier League club had already been linked with the Colombian earlier this summer, before Olympiacos joined the picture.
